    You have to leave room on the left/right for the arrows or use CSS to move them inside the slider.

    Thanks, Ron. I had the box set to hold images up to 600px and the images are 600px from the featured images. Does that mean I need to manually resize the featured images? Or, of course, the CSS option.

    Going the size route means you have to use your widget width less 2 x arrow width. So, if your widget is 600 then try a width of 540.

    You can use the regenerate thumbnails plugin to generate the correct sized images for the slider after you change the slider size.
